I loved the tension between Colt and Ashlyn. I loved their back and forth retorts and the initial push-pull.
I loved Colt. I loved how he was so adamant in his feelings from the get-go. I loved that he called her “Sunshine,” and I loved his knightly actions.
Its refreshing to have a “best friends ex,” trope without overly dramatized push-pull.
I do wish there was a bit more hockey in this hockey romance but hopefully the rest of the series will include more.
Most characters are lovable, but I did deduct .5 since nearly all of the characters knew their friends’ major issues (cheating and briefly mentioned domestic abuse) and it was all so easily excused or ignored. It was a bit disappointing, especially when a few of those characters are so protective of others — I’m looking at you Theo.
